The Apiculture Market is projected to grow by USD 15.65 billion at a CAGR of 5.08% by 2032.
| KEY MARKET STATISTICS | |
|---|---|
| Base Year [2024] | USD 10.53 billion |
| Estimated Year [2025] | USD 11.07 billion |
| Forecast Year [2032] | USD 15.65 billion |
| CAGR (%) | 5.08% |

Segmentation analysis reveals distinct commercial pathways tied to product, application, distribution, hive architecture, and bee species, each demanding targeted approaches. Based on Product Type, consumers and industrial users show different preferences across Comb Honey, Creamed Honey, Honey Powder & Granules, and Liquid Honey, with packaging, processing, and storage requirements varying significantly by format. Based on Application, the needs of Cosmetics & Personal Care differ from Food & Beverages and Pharmaceuticals in formulation constraints, impurity tolerances, and certification expectations, creating separate product development and quality assurance roadmaps.
Based on Distribution Channel, the complexity of go-to-market operations is influenced by Convenience Stores, Direct Sales, Online Retail, Specialty Stores, and Supermarkets & Hypermarkets, and a closer look shows that Online Retail is further subdivided into Brand Websites and Marketplaces, each with unique promotional dynamics, return behaviors, and margin structures. Based on Hive Type, production practices and scale economics differ between Flow Hive, Langstroth Hive, and Top-Bar Hive systems, affecting harvest frequency, labor skill sets, and the potential for mechanized processing. Based on Bee Type, Apis Cerana and Apis Mellifera exhibit variations in foraging behavior, climate adaptability, and susceptibility to pests and disease, which in turn shape geography-specific management protocols and product consistency expectations.
Taken together, these segmentation lenses illustrate that one-size-fits-all strategies are unlikely to succeed. Instead, operators and brands should map product formulations, quality systems, and channel strategies to the specific demands of each segmentation intersection, thereby aligning operational investments with revenue and margin opportunities that reflect real-world buyer requirements.
